Transaction 85aa8b156fe40a85ad96299ae4c010611f701835acf14bbb8136a6aedbbb0bb0
1 Input
1 Output
-
85aa8b156fe40a85ad96299ae4c010611f701835acf14bbb8136a6aedbbb0bb0:0
- value
- 3414500
- script pubkey
- OP_0 OP_PUSHBYTES_20 74b36deb7cc7fe1e70e2953e290e25b5e5fcd1a9
- address
- bc1qwjekm6mucllpuu8zj5lzjr39khjle5dfu6fqlp